Nginx - Administrering av tjenesten

Innholdsfortegnelse
Når vi har serveren vår Nginx installert riktig, er det neste trinnet vi må følge for å kunne kontrollere og administrere tjenestene, for dette må vi ha tilgang til maskinen der vi har installert den, enten fysisk eller eksternt.
Nginx -tjenesten
Til installer Nginx den typiske beliggenheten er / usr / local / nginx dette på Debian / Ubuntu -systemer, skal vi ta denne ruten fra nå av.
For å klare og kontrollere noe må vi først forstå hva det handler om; Først må vi vite at det er to typer applikasjoner, de som kjøres synlig og de som ikke gjør det.
De som løper fra synlig form Det er de som lar oss som brukere se dem og handle direkte med dem, for eksempel tekstbehandler.
Søknadene som ikke kjør synlig er samtalene demoner eller demonapplikasjoner, de kjører bak kulissene så å si, vanligvis kan vi ikke ha direkte kontakt med dem, et eksempel kan være cron, applikasjonen som lar oss utføre planlagte prosesser.
ViktigSom mange allerede har antatt, Nginx er en demon -applikasjonSiden siden vi starter den, kjører den uten å bli sett av brukeren og manifesterer seg bare i prosesslederen.
Start Nginx
Dette er det viktigste trinnet og et av de enkleste, for at tjenesten vår skal begynne å fungere, må vi bare starte den med kommandoen:
/ usr / local / nginx

Med dette må serveren vår starte, ellers vil den vise oss feilen, men hvis vi ikke får en melding, gikk alt riktig.
Kommandolinjeargumenter
Nginx lar oss inkludere argumenter i kommandolinjen når vi ringer til tjenesten, med dette kan vi aktivere funksjoner eller utføre en bestemt aktivitet, for å kjenne listen vi kan bruke nginx -h kommando og vi kan se noe som ligner på følgende bilde:

Vi skal nå fokusere på å kontrollere applikasjonen, for dette skal vi bruke -s parameter Avhengig av hva som følger med det, kan vi utføre forskjellige handlinger, la oss se hva vi har tilgjengelig:
nginx -s stoppStopper applikasjonen umiddelbart uansett hva som kjører.
nginx -s avsluttGjør en formtjeneste stoppe grasiøstDet vil si at den stopper tjenesten og får prosessene til å slutte helt.
nginx -s åpner igjenGjør en ny åpning av loggfiler.
nginx -s last inn på nyttLast inn tjenestekonfigurasjonen på nytt igjen.
ViktigDet er viktig å nevne at når vi utfører noen av disse handlingene med nginx -tjeneste, Først blir konfigurasjonsfilen verifisert, hvis den inneholder en feil, vil utførelsen av de forskjellige kommandoene resultere i en feil, dette skjer selv om vi stopper tjenesten helt, så for å stoppe tjenesten må vi ha en filgyldig konfigurasjon.
Hvis vi ikke kan korrigere konfigurasjonsfilen, og vi raskt må avslutte tjenesten vi kan bruke Drep alle som en siste utvei:
killall nginx

Etter å ha fullført denne opplæringen kan vi allerede ha en grunnleggende kontroll over tjenesten vår Nginx i tillegg til å vite hvilke kommandoer du skal bruke for å kontrollere den.Likte og hjalp du denne opplæringen?Du kan belønne forfatteren ved å trykke på denne knappen for å gi ham et positivt poeng

Du vil bidra til utvikling av området, dele siden med vennene dine

wave wave wave wave wave